When it comes to performance horses, the name Driftwood is one of the most well known single word names of the industry.
A brief timeline of Driftwood shows he was foaled in 1932 at the ranch of Bailey Childress in Silverton, Texas. His next owners were Sam and Amos Turner two years later, also of Silverton. In 1939 he was purchased...
